From c938e3e5777cfbd02699918a32cd44fa8e97c565 Mon Sep 17 00:00:00 2001
From: spring <2396852758@qq.com>
Date: 星期一, 23 三月 2026 11:14:46 +0800
Subject: [PATCH] fix: 耗材出库调整
---
src/pages/consumablesLogistics/stockManagement/subtract.vue | 15 ++++-----------
1 files changed, 4 insertions(+), 11 deletions(-)
diff --git a/src/pages/consumablesLogistics/stockManagement/subtract.vue b/src/pages/consumablesLogistics/stockManagement/subtract.vue
index e127d95..e32405c 100644
--- a/src/pages/consumablesLogistics/stockManagement/subtract.vue
+++ b/src/pages/consumablesLogistics/stockManagement/subtract.vue
@@ -47,12 +47,7 @@
const type = ref("0");
const isQualified = computed(() => true);
-const stockRecord = reactive({
- id: "",
- productName: "",
- model: "",
- unLockedQuantity: 0,
-});
+const stockRecord = reactive({});
const form = reactive({
stockOutNum: "",
@@ -66,10 +61,7 @@
try {
const payload = typeof cached === "string" ? JSON.parse(cached) : cached;
const item = payload && payload.item != null ? payload.item : payload;
- stockRecord.id = item.id;
- stockRecord.productName = item.productName;
- stockRecord.model = item.model;
- stockRecord.unLockedQuantity = item.unLockedQuantity || 0;
+ Object.assign(stockRecord, item || {});
uni.removeStorageSync("stockSubtractRecord");
} catch (e) {
uni.removeStorageSync("stockSubtractRecord");
@@ -84,8 +76,9 @@
return;
}
subtractConsumablesIn({
+ ...stockRecord,
id: stockRecord.id,
- stockOutNum: outNum,
+ qualitity: outNum,
remark: form.remark,
})
.then(() => {
--
Gitblit v1.9.3